Worm Digest Writer’s Guidelines

August 19, 2006

Worm Digest, first published in summer 1993, is a quarterly magazine that aims to offer readers “knowledge regarding anything to do with earthworms.” Worm Digest is a non-profit organization that displays no favoritism or political or business affiliation and we are in a transition process to take the original magazine to another level. 

1. We request writers to send an email query letter to Editor at This email address is being protected from spam bots, you need Javascript enabled to view it to first contact us with a story idea.

2. Stories should be written in MS Word and submitted on deadline with an approximate length of 1200-1500 words or more.

3. Stories should be written in a journalistic style (i.e. the AP style) so that people can easily understand the content.

4. High resolution digital photos that are ready for print are highly recommended. 

5. So far at this moment, Worm Digest will not pay for articles published on the magazine.

6. Worm Digest reserves the right to edit all submissions from contributors.

Departments

We are looking for stories that are related to vermicomposting, earthworm-related environmental and educational issues, business news and research findings.

  • Features: 1500-2500 words. We expect stories with depth, quality and interest to our general readers.

  • Research: 1200-1500 words. Tell the general audience the latest scientific findings in vermicomposting or vermicology. Contributors should bear in mind to always translate the jargon to our readers.

  • Business: 800-1000 words. A brief profile of the latest products in the vermicomposting industry. The business department aims to provide services to our readers with full knowledge about products in the market. Please note that Worm Digest does not endorse products printed in the magazine.

  • Education: 1200-1500 words. We look for stories that focus on regional or national trends in vermicomposting or vermicology education.

  • Reviews: 200-700 words. We publish reviews of books, videos and other media productions.

  • Earthworm & Environment: 1200-1500 words. We expect stories with a connection between the environment and earthworm not only in the United States, but also around the world.

  • We also accept stories that do not fit into any of the categories but provide an interesting angle to our readers. Prior to submission, please contact the editor for story ideas.
